基于模拟退火法和Floyd优化算法的农村应急物流配送路径研究  被引量:6

摘  要:农村地区自然灾害的频繁发生,给农民的生产生活带来严重威胁,因此保障农村居民的生命财产安全显得尤为重要。针对农村应急物流配送路径优化问题,在算法上采用模拟退火法及Floyd优化算法进行配送路径的优化研究,同时综合考虑“配送车辆”和“配送车辆+无人机”两种不同的配送方式,构建解决相关问题的优化模型。结果显示,文章采用的模型和求解算法能为不同情境下农村应急物流的配送活动选择出最优配送路径,保证在最短时间内完成应急配送任务,提高了配送效率。Frequent occurrence of natural disasters in rural areas poses a serious threat to the production and life of farmers,so it is particularly important to ensure rural residents'lives and property.Aiming at the optimization problem of rural emergency logistics distribution path,simulated annealing method and Floyd optimization algorithm are used to optimize the distribution path.At the same time,two different distribution methods,"distribution vehicle"and"distribution vehicle+UAV",are comprehensively considered to build an optimization model to solve related problems.The results show that the proposed model and algorithm can select the optimal distribution path for rural emergency logistics distribution activities in different situations,and ensure the completion of emergency distribution tasks in the shortest time,which improves the distribution efficiency.
